How to Choose the Right Floor Sanding Company in Auckland
- Check the timber they work with. Rimu, matai, kauri and tawa behave differently from imported oak or engineered board, and not every sander handles parquet, cork or particle board.
- Ask whether you actually need a full sand. A maintenance recoat costs far less where the existing coating is still bonded, and an honest operator will say so on site.
- Look at the finish options offered. Water based polyurethane, moisture cured polyurethane, hardwax oil and stain all wear and look different, and the right one depends on traffic, pets and light.
- Pin down what dust control means in practice. No sanding is genuinely dust free, so ask about extraction on the main machine and how edges and corners are handled.
- Get the scope in writing. A quote should cover preparation, repairs, number of coats, drying times and when furniture can go back, not just a square metre rate.
Frequently Asked Questions About Auckland Floor Sanding
How much does floor sanding cost in Auckland?
Rates are quoted per square metre and vary with the condition of the floor and the finish chosen. FlooringPro publishes its Auckland rates as $43 per square metre for a clean and recoat with two clear coats, $76 for standard sanding with three coats, and $110 for heavy duty sanding with a stain and two clear coats, excluding GST, with a 25 square metre minimum booking. Stairs are usually priced per step. Other operators quote after an on site measure rather than publishing rates.
How long does floor sanding take?
Most standard residential floors take one to three working days, depending on the area, the repairs needed, the coating system and drying time between coats. Larger commercial floors and halls are usually staged so parts of the building stay in use.
Can any timber floor be sanded?
Solid tongue and groove, parquet, particle board, strand board, plywood and cork can all normally be sanded. Engineered timber is the exception: it can only be sanded if enough wear layer remains, so the thickness and any previous sanding need checking before the job is approved.
Is floor sanding dust free?
No sanding process is completely dust free, and any operator claiming otherwise is overselling. Professional extraction on the main drum sander captures most of it, with edge and corner work being the harder part to contain. Wood dust is a recognised workplace health hazard, and guidance on managing exposure is published by WorkSafe New Zealand.
Should I recoat or fully sand my floor?
If the coating is worn but still bonded and the damage has not reached the timber, a recoat or reglaze is usually enough and costs considerably less. Widespread scratching, failed or flaking coating, uneven colour or damage that has gone into the timber points to a full sand and refinish.
What finish should I choose?
Water based polyurethane dries lighter and has lower odour, moisture cured polyurethane is harder wearing and suits busy family homes, oil gives a subtle matt look that can be spot repaired, and stain changes the colour of the timber before a clear coat goes on. Ask for sample patches on your own floor, since the same stain reads differently on rimu, matai and oak.
Do I need to move out while the work is done?
Furniture has to come out of the rooms being sanded, and the floor cannot be walked on between coats. Many households stay put and work around the programme, but odour from solvent based coatings and the drying schedule make a couple of nights elsewhere easier. Dry to touch, safe to walk on, furniture back and fully cured are four different milestones, so ask for dates for each.
What should be in the quote before I sign?
A clear scope covering preparation, any board repairs, the number of coats, the product being used, dust control and the timeline. Getting it in writing before work starts is the main protection if the finished result does not match what was agreed, and general guidance on dealing with tradespeople and resolving disputes is available from Consumer NZ.
